Aden sat bolt upright and wrenched his hand out of Belle's. He jumped off the bed and Belle thought he was about to start verbally ripping into her. But he didnt. He just stood, looking at her, with so many emotions fighting fo centre stage on his face that she couldnt quite place them all. There was anger, a real uncontrollable rage, pain, anguish and also fear. But fear of what? His eyes were wild and it terrified her. He held his wrist as though it burned from her touch. Belle subconciously held her breath, just waiting to see what he would do. Then, fast as lightning, he climbed out of the window and vanished into the night.

'Wait-!' she called after him, but he didnt return. He didnt return all night and eventually, yearning to feel his arms around her, holding her safe and warm, she drifted into a restless, dreamless sleep.

-

When she woke in the morning to her surprise there was a letter to her on her bedside table. She picked it up warily, knowing there was only one person it could be from. No one else's handwriting was that bad.

Belle, (it read)

I'm sorry about last night. Come to Roman's for breakfast and we'll talk. Promise.

Aden xx

ps you look beautiful when you sleep.

and that was it. She almost felt relieved that she hadnt been awake when he had returned. She sighed and got dressed and not long later she found herself at Roman's door. She knocked on it and Aden, dressed in the same clothes as the night before with dishevelled hair and tired eyes opened it to her.

'You came...' he sighed with relief. 'I didnt know if you would.' He let her in and they went through to the kitchen.

'Why wouldnt I? And, not going to school today?' she asked as they sat down at the table.

'I dunno,' he shrugged. 'After last night...i guess...i dunno....' he trailed off, rubbing his eyes. 'And no..im not.'

'Forget last night,' Belle said firmly. 'It doesnt matter.' She leaned over the table and kissed him as he had kissed her the night before, softly and tenderly. He smiled and sighed with relief.

'I dont deserve you.' he shook his head and leaned in to kiss her again.

'I know!' she teased him.

They sat and ate together, the mood definitely lighter as Aden mercilessly teased Belle and she took it all with a roll of the eyes. After they'd finished eating they sat in silence for a few minutes, neither quite knowing how to approach the subject of the night before.

Eventually Belle asked, 'Can i see it?'

He obediantly held his arm towards her, though somewhat reluctantly. She took it gently and turned it over. In daylight the scars that were dashed across his wrist looked even worse and she understood why he wanted to cover them at all times. She lightly traced the web of white scars - they felt cold to the touch.

'Was this from an accident?' she asked, looking up at him, willing for it to be so.

His eyes met hers, searching in them, trying to find the answer she wanted to hear. But in the end he couldnt. 'No' he whispered.

'when, then?' she asked gently, not wanting to push him. He looked away from her, drawing his arm back in towards himself as though if she couldnt see the scars she would just forget about them. All he wanted was for her to forget and for himself to forget too.

'Aden, you promised we would talk...i only want to help you.'

Aden took her hands in his suddenly and looked at her in earnest, 'I know.' he said. 'I know. Which is why it's so hard to tell you things like this because....'

He stopped, as though trying to collect the words he would use.

'10.' he said shortly. 'I was 10. I tried to kill myself when i was 10.'

Belle gasped in shock. The attempted suicide she had already guessed at but she couldnt quite comprehend the age it had happened at. 10?? What could've happened to make a 10 year old want to die so much he cut his own wrist? She couldnt get her head round it.

'Why?' she blurted out eventually, wanting to understand.

'That...' he replied with a sigh. 'I'm not ready to tell you that...yet....'

She nodded and put her hand to his face, cupping his cheek and collecting the few stray tears that fell from his eyes. 'Thank you,' she said. 'thank you for telling me this. whenever you need me i'm here. i'm always here.'

They let their foreheads rest against one anothers, their eyes closed and though neither said it they both knew they loved each other.

Their moment was abruptly interrupted when the letter box slammed as a white envelope fell to the floor in front of the door. Aden sighed and went to pick it up. Turning it over he realised it was addressed to him and was puzzled as no one ever sent him anything. He ripped it open and quickly scanned the typed letter.

'What is it?' Belle called from the kitchen, as he hadnt said anything for several minutes. He didnt reply.

'Aden?!' she wandered into the sitting room to find Aden standing in shock, his face drained of all colour, staring at the page. 'Aden, you're scaring me, whats going on?'

His hand shaking, he held out the page for her to read. In the middle of the page all it said was,

I KNOW YOUR SECRET.

'I know your secret?' Belle breathed in confusion. 'What-?'

But Aden's expression had changed and now he looked scarily angry, more so than the night before. He ripped the page out of Belle's hand and stormed out of the house.

'Aden, wait! where're you going?!' Belle ran out after him, trying to keep up. She was surprised when he turned into the house next door and burst through the front door. 'Aden, you cant go in there! it's not your house!' she tried to stop him but he ignored her.

'Where is she?' he yelled.

'Who???' Belle asked desperately as she followed him into the house, an exact mirror of Roman's.

'LOUEY!!' Aden shouted, his voice raging through the place. 'Louey, where the hell are you!!'

'What???' Louey stuck her head around the door of the kitchen. 'Aden, i cant really talk right now, i'm already late for school...hey, why arent you-'

Aden stormed up to her and shoved the letter in her face, 'What the HELL is this?' he demanded.

As she read it a look of complete horror came across her face, 'Aden, i don't know what-'

'Who did you tell?' he cut over her sharply. She looked at him in shock, not quite comprehending the question he was asking her. 'Who did you tell Louey?' he demanded to know again.

'How dare you!' her voice hissed at him in an icy whisper. 'How DARE you even think that i would tell anyone!'

'No one. else. knew.' he accused through clenched teeth.

'How can you accuse me of telling someone though! Me of all people! I would tell someone that as much as you would tell someone-' she looked up sharply as though only noticing Belle for the first time. She cocked an eyebrow, 'Hmm, maybe it was her.'

Aden looked over his shoulder at Belle. He was ashamed to admit it, but he had forgotten all about her. 'She doesnt know.' he said in a quieter voice. 'And she doesnt need to know.'

'Well you're the one shouting about it Aden, so screw your head on a little more and get real. You know i wouldnt do that to you, now get out of my way i've got to go to school.' she started to push past him and bumped into Justin as he came down the stairs.

'What's all the shouting about?' he asked.

Louey glared at him. 'Ask him.' she spat, stabbing a finger in Aden's direction and left the house, slamming the front door shut with a bang.

'What did you do?' Justin sighed.

'I didnt do anything!' Aden protested, pushing the letter at Justin.

Justin scanned it quickly and raised an eyebrow at Aden, 'Tell me you didnt accuse Louey of having something to do with this.'

'Well...'

Justin ran a hand through his hair, sighing in despair, 'Seriously Aden? Seriously? Think about it for five minutes, just 5, its not hard. even you can hold a thought that long.'

Belle let a small giggle out and immediately felt guilty. This was obviously a very serious time where giggling was not allowed, as both brothers just looked at her.

'And you must be Belle.' Justin fixed her with a dashing smile and held out his hand for her to shake. 'I'm Justin, Aden's older, smarter and much better looking brother.'

Aden snorted in disagreement.

'No doubt, Aden's been telling you all manner of wonderful stories about me.' he laughed but stopped when he saw the look on Aden's face. 'Or...maybe not....anyways.'

'Uhh..how dyou know who i am?' Belle stuttered, feeling slightly overwhelmed by the sudden arrival of Aden's brother.

'Darling, Aden never shuts up about you. I know a lot about you. hmm..its actually slightly creepy how much i know about you. Anyway!' he turned back to Aden. 'Fuss, can i talk to you in the kitchen for a minute?'

'Fuss?' Belle asked and Aden glared at his brother for letting his childhood nickname slip...just another thing he would have to explain to Belle.

He sighed, 'C'mon.' he muttered and pulled Justin into the kitchen.

Belle observed them exchange words from a distance. If you saw them each separately you would never guess they were brothers, but watching them together and you would know. They were so similar in their mannerisms but yet so different, as Justin was very open and easy going and Aden was caged and guarded, completely cutting off everything else. She started to feel very awkward watching them, especially Justin. There was something about the way he looked at Aden...so much love and sorrow...and regret? was that it? She looked away, choosing instead to study her fingernails. She was contemplating sneaking quietly out the front door when she heard Aden's voice, so tired and resigned.

It was almost pleading. 'I want it to stop. I just want it to stop.'

She looked up and the sight almost broke her heart. Aden, too tired to cry even, had his head resting on Justin's shoulder while Justin just about held him up. She felt tears well up in her eyes and she blinked them away.

Justin suddenly looked up and straight into her eyes and she felt like she was intruding on them. She made a movement to go, but Justin shook his head and motioned for her to stay. So she stayed and after a completely exhausted Aden had been led home Justin returned and came to talk to her.

He took her hands in his, looked her straight in the eyes with all the seriousness in the world and asked her, 'How much do you love him?'
